Several Pokémon have been temporarily owned by Team Rocket in the Pokémon anime.

Pokémon temporarily owned by James

James's Gyarados
Gyarados
James purchased his Gyarados as a Magikarp on the St. Anne. While on the ocean liner, the Magikarp salesman tricked him into buying what he said was a valuable Magikarp inside a gold Poké Ball. Jessie told James that Magikarp is a completely useless Pokémon, and Meowth informed James that the Poké Ball was only gold-plated.

When the St. Anne sank, James tried using Magikarp to help them escape, but it only made their situation worse. After finally making it to the surface, Meowth tried to take a bite out of it. His teeth broke off from the hard skin, and James, angry at how useless it was, kicked it into the ocean. The kick caused Magikarp to evolve into Gyarados. Using Dragon Rage, James's Gyarados and several other Gyarados sent Team Rocket, Ash and his friends flying. James's Gyarados was never seen again.

James's Victreebel
Victreebel
In the episode Here's Lookin' at You, Elekid, James is pushed into trading his old Victreebel for a Weepinbell by Jessie and Meowth after the Magikarp salesman cons them by saying they can use its Sweet Scent to capture Pokémon.

Later in the episode this Weepinbell evolves into Victreebel, and it tries to gobble Jessie (much like the previous Victreebel did with James). This causes her to command her Arbok to send the Flycatcher Pokémon flying. At the same time the Magikarp salesman realizes that James's original Victreebel will not obey him, and he kicks it away. The two Victreebel meet, fall in love, and skip off into the forest.

James's Hoppip
Hoppip
James bought Hoppip from the Magikarp salesman in Who's Flying Now?. It was painted to look like a Chimecho, which James had wanted since he was a child. James recognized the salesman, but he was able to convince James that he had turned over a new leaf and was now an honest person. Believing him, James bought the Hoppip in disguise.

When he showed it to Jessie and Meowth, they were less than impressed with the Chimecho. Meowth immediately realized it was a fake, and when it started falling apart, James rubbed it with a rag. All the paint came off, and the Chimecho was revealed to be a fake. Before James could do anything, the Hoppip floated away, never to be seen again.

James's Aggron
Aggron
In Grating Spaces!, Delibird gave Jessie and James two Poké Balls containing a Charizard and an Aggron. Excited at having two strong Pokémon, they decided to use them to attack the Pewter Gym and steal the gym's Poké Balls. When they entered, they challenged Brock and Ash to a double battle.

Using their Donphan and Steelix, the two friends tried to defeat Team Rocket's newly acquired Pokémon. However, the Aggron and Charizard were stronger and gained an early advantage. The battle was ended when Max discovered that the two Trainers were indeed Team Rocket in disguise. With the help of Forrest, Team Rocket were sent blasting off and Pewter Gym was safe.

At the end of the day, Delibird returned and took the two Pokémon back , as the Charizard and Aggron were originally intended for Cassidy and Butch, respectively. Before Team Rocket could question what it was doing, it was gone, and Aggron and Charizard haven't been seen since.

Pokémon temporarily owned by Jessie

Jessie's Shellder
Shellder
Shellder's only appearance was in The Evolution Solution. Giovanni had ordered Jessie and James to dig for clams on the beach of Seafoam Islands. James hit something with his shovel, and yanked it out of the ground, revealing it to be a Shellder. James sent out his Weezing to battle it. Shellder hit hard with Ice Beam, while Weezing knocked it out with Haze. James was going to throw a Poké Ball at it, but Jessie beat him to it, capturing Shellder. James complained about this, as it was his Weezing that weakened the Shellder. Later on, Jessie and James attempted to steal all the Pokémon at Professor Westwood V's lab, but found that all he had was a Slowpoke. In the hopes that a Slowbro would prove more valuable to Giovanni, Jessie sent out Shellder and ordered it to clamp down on Slowpoke's tail. However, Westwood's Slowpoke avoided the Shellder with a truly surprising amount of speed. After some misdirected Clamps (including Psyduck's head and tail, the former enabling Psyduck to remove the Bivalve Pokémon with Confusion), Shellder finally clamped down on Slowpoke's tail, causing it to evolve into Slowbro. Team Rocket tried to steal it, but Slowbro sent them blasting off again with Mega Punch (after using Amnesia to temporarily forget it). After this episode, neither Shellder nor the Slowbro were seen again.

Jessie's Magikarp
Magikarp
Magikarp's only appearance came in Pearls are a Spoink's Best Friend. After stealing Spoink's pearl, Team Rocket came across the Magikarp salesman who convinced Jessie to trade the pearl for what he claimed to be a Feebas. Jessie was reluctant at first until the salesman explained to her that Feebas evolve into Milotic, after which Jessie eagerly made the trade, despite the protests of James and Meowth.

Later, Team Rocket was seen at a lake letting Jessie's "Feebas" swim around in a stream. The paint started to run, and soon it was revealed that the Feebas was actually a Magikarp. This discovery infuriated Jessie, and Team Rocket sought out the salesman to demand a refund. When they found the salesman, Ash and his friends were already there. A battle between Cacnea and Dustox against Pikachu and Spoink ensued, during which the salesman escaped, and Magikarp was completely lost track of. Team Rocket was defeated in the end and the pearl was returned to Spoink. The Magikarp has never been seen again so it is believed not to belong to Jessie anymore.

Jessie's Charizard
Charizard
Jessie obtained Charizard in Grating Spaces! when Delibird gave her and James two Poké Balls. When they learned the Poké Balls contained a Charizard and an Aggron, they decided to use them to take over Pewter Gym and steal the Gym's Poké Balls.

Using their disguises, they challenged Brock and Ash to a double battle. Team Rocket sent out their newly acquired Pokémon, while Brock and Ash sent out their Steelix and Donphan, respectively. Unfortunately, Team Rocket got an early advantage and appeared to be winning. The victory was short-lived when Max discovered Meowth stealing all of the Gym's Poké Balls. It was then revealed that the two were indeed Team Rocket. With the help of Forrest, they were sent blasting off.

At the end of the day, Delibird returned to take the Poké Balls back, as the Charizard and Aggron were originally intended for Cassidy and Butch, respectively. Before Team Rocket could plead with Delibird to return them, it had flown away.

Pokémon temporarily owned by both James and Jessie

Team Rocket's Porygon
Porygon
Porygon was a prototype created by Dr. Akihabara and stolen by Team Rocket. It was also called "Porygon Zero" in the episode. Ash and his friends borrowed a non-prototype Porygon to go inside the computer world to find it. When they encountered the trio, Team Rocket sent out Porygon to battle Ash and friends, complete with its own "TR" flag on its tail.

Sadly, when the vaccine was released by Nurse Joy, one of them hit Team Rocket, knocking Porygon unconscious. When fleeing Dr. Akihabara's ruined house, they left Porygon behind for reasons unknown.

Because its only appearance was in an episode that aired only once in the world, it is the only Pokémon owned by a main character at some point that virtually no longer exists even in Japan, and the only Pokémon owned by a main character to have never been seen officially outside of Japan.
